Address NBpg4Fdat5HtGRmPEhAJVGNTFm8Htbj7zF

Total received 128.52882146 NMC
Total sent 128.52882146 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Jan. 25, 2022, 3:57 p.m. 26dfe5ac4… 596031 128.52882146 NMC 0.00000000 NMC
Jan. 25, 2022, 3:57 p.m. 6f17dd0ba… 596031 128.52882146 NMC 0.00000000 NMC